Output 31efc11192a62555d90249870d617fe5ffdddd7681c8e696a4fa4fc45c99163b:0

value
27529202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06f0dabccc0e3aa32d7814a52d6225ec3d818f45 OP_EQUAL
address
32KiWZ8jXsfmEoAnkYxfgpnfjkJvwUK1uX
transaction
31efc11192a62555d90249870d617fe5ffdddd7681c8e696a4fa4fc45c99163b
spent
true